Kit Components

Ensure your kit includes all essential items needed to establish and maintain your beehive. A complete kit should typically have a bee suit with a veil, hive tool, bee brush, smoker, entrance reducer, brood chamber, frames with foundation, honey super, inner cover, telescoping lid, and protective gloves. Additionally, opt for kits that provide instructional guides or books, helping you understand the basics of beekeeping.

Tips For Using Beekeeping Kits Safely

Taking safety precautions is crucial when using your beekeeping kit. Here are essential tips to ensure a safe experience while tending to your bees.

Protective Gear

Wearing the right protective gear is vital for your safety. Always use a well-fitted bee suit, gloves, and a veil to minimize the risk of bee stings. Ensure your gear is clean and free from openings where bees could enter. Also, consider using durable boots to protect your feet while working around the hive. Keeping this gear in good condition will help you feel more confident when handling your bees.

Tools Maintenance

Maintaining your beekeeping tools is essential for both safety and efficiency. Regularly clean your smoker to prevent residue buildup, ensuring it works correctly during hive inspections. Check your hive tool for rust and sharp edges, and replace it if necessary. Keeping all tools organized and easily accessible will streamline your beekeeping tasks. Regular maintenance helps prevent accidents and ensures you’re prepared for any situation.

Bee Handling Techniques

Practicing proper bee handling techniques keeps both you and your bees safe. Approach your hive calmly to avoid startling the bees. Use gentle movements while inspecting the hive and avoid any sudden jerks. When using the smoker, puff a small amount of smoke at the entrance before opening the hive to calm the bees. Remember, a few minutes of patience will help make for a smoother experience, reducing the likelihood of bee aggression.
